Do long haired dogs get cold in the winter?

While most dogs have enough fur to keep them warm, the length of the fur actually does make a difference in their insulation.

Longer and thicker fur means your dog will stay much warmer in cold temperatures

. That’s why many owners of longer-haired breeds avoid grooming their doggos too often in the winter.

How can I tell if my dog is cold?

  1. Shaking or shivering.
  2. Hunched posture with a tucked tail.
  3. Whining or barking.
  4. Change in behaviour, like seeming anxious or uncomfortable.
  5. Reluctance to keep walking or tries to turn around.
  6. Seeks places for shelter.
  7. Lifts paw off the ground.

Is it too cold to walk the dog?

In General. Most healthy, medium or large dogs with thick coats can take a 30 minute walk when temperatures are above 20°. Small dogs or dogs with thin coats start to become uncomfortable in temperatures below 45°.

Consider limiting walks to 15 minutes for these dogs when temps fall below freezing

.

What is too cold for a short haired dog?

When temperatures start to fall below 45°F, some cold-averse breeds will get uncomfortable and will need protection. For owners of small breeds, puppies, senior dogs, or thin haired breeds, anytime the temperature outside feels at or

below 32°F

, pull out the sweaters or coats!

Is 30 degrees to cold for a dog?

“Under 30 degrees, factoring in the wind chill,

it’s not going to be safe for any dog to be outside for an extended period of time

,” Smyth says.” You can buy yourself a little bit of time with warm weather clothing,” such as dog sweaters and booties to cover their paws.

Are Newfoundlands good in snow?

When it comes to cold weather dog breeds that love the snow,

Newfoundlands are at the top of the list

. Originally bred to work in icy waters, the Canadian dogs have ultra heavy coats and strong bodies that protect them from frigid waters and snowy mountains.
